Rabby Wallet is a browser extension developed by the team behind DeBank, a well-known DeFi portfolio tracking platform. It allows users to manage their cryptocurrency assets, interact with decentralized applications (dApps), and execute blockchain transactions with enhanced security and transparency.
Unlike traditional wallets that often require manual network switching, Rabby Wallet automatically detects the correct blockchain network when interacting with dApps. This reduces user errors and ensures smoother transactions across different ecosystems like Ethereum, BNB Chain, Polygon, and more.
Here are some of the major benefits that make Rabby Wallet stand out in the crowded Web3 wallet space:
One of Rabby’s most convenient features is its ability to automatically switch to the correct network when you connect to a dApp. This eliminates the hassle of manually selecting networks and prevents failed or incorrect transactions.
Rabby Wallet shows a clear preview of every transaction before you approve it. It highlights potential risks such as suspicious smart contracts or unusual token transfers—giving users an added layer of security.
With built-in support for multiple blockchains, Rabby Wallet enables users to interact with a wide range of decentralized platforms without installing separate wallets or extensions.
Rabby actively monitors smart contract interactions and alerts users if there’s any risk involved in signing a transaction. This feature is especially helpful in avoiding phishing attacks and malicious dApps.
Already using MetaMask or another wallet? Rabby allows you to import your existing wallet securely, so you don’t need to create a new one or transfer assets manually.
